I defrag about 4 times a year on the machines I can't rebuild (corporate assets etc) and always notice a speed improvement. If you don't add/remove files much it won't be as necessary, but if you do a lot of installing and uninstalling you're actually better off rebuilding once a quarter or so (which is what I do with my home machines)

Of course all the above only applies to Windows machines. The filesystems I use under *nix have little need for anything like this, and they also cope better with uninstalling correctly.
